It’s never too early to start planning for the future! So students at E.C. Brice Elementary began thinking about their possible futures on Thursday, March 21 when they attended the Brice Career Expo. Representatives from ten local businesses set up tables in the Brice gym so that students could learn about college, the military, and different areas of the workforce. The students rotated through each business and were able to ask questions and learn more about having a job when they get older. Business and their representatives included: Castillo Realty—MPHS graduate Suzie Castillo with Theresa Preciado and Eliana Mejia Chick-Fil-A—MPHS graduate Melanie Knight and Wendy Standridge Chillz on Wheelz—MPHS graduates Rachel Narramore and Sarah Flanagan East Texas Children’s Dentistry—MPISD Board member Dr. Kenny Thompson Mount Pleasant Fire Department—MPHS graduates Cody Craig and Chase Higginbotham Northeast Texas Community College—MPHS graduate Ja’Quacy Minter Photo Booth Graphics—MPHS graduate Clay Moore Texas Department of Public Safety—MPHS graduate Trooper Edgardo Godoy Titus County Sheriff’s Office—MPHS graduate Corporal Ashlyne Godoy U.S. Army Recruitment Center—PFC Samuel Hampton and Staff Sergeant Ramiro Herrera If you or your business would like to participate in the future, contact Jana Moore at E.C. Brice Elementary.
